This thread has been locked.

If you have a related question, please click the "Ask a related question" button in the top right corner. The newly created question will be automatically linked to this question.

[参考译文] ADS1262EVM-PDK:ADS126xEVM-PDK LabVIEW 中的测量方法

Guru**** 1101410 points
Other Parts Discussed in Thread: ADCPRO, ADS1263EVM-PDK
请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

https://e2e.ti.com/support/data-converters-group/data-converters/f/data-converters-forum/800108/ads1262evm-pdk-measurement-method-in-labview-of-ads126xevm-pdk

器件型号:ADS1262EVM-PDK

我想使用 ADS126xEVM-PDK 在 LabVIEW 中收集数据。 数据需要以大约200Hz 的采样率记录振动加速度传感器的输出。 但是、我不理解 LabVIEW 上硬件的控制方法。

在目前的情况下,它处于以下状态。

我可以使用 ADCPro 采集数据。

2.我可以通过 LabVIEW 的示例程序获取数据。

3.我可以通过 LabVIEW 程序连接到硬件,但不了解寄存器的注释方法和命令的传输方法。

是否有好的方法? 如果您能向我展示、我很高兴。 提前感谢您的帮助。

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。
    您好!

    欢迎访问 TI E2E 论坛!

    对于 ADS1263EVM-PDK、无论您使用 ADCPro 还是独立的 LabVIEW 驱动程序、需要注意的一点是、LabVIEW 应用只能在单个"块"中收集有限数量的样本、但当使用 EVM 持续采集数据时、"块"可能不包含连续数据 (例如、收集块之间可能缺少一些样本)。 您可以增加块大小(最多一个点)以确保您的样本在时间上都是连续的;但是、对于较大的数据集、此 EVM 可能不是连续数据收集的最佳工具。

    LabVIEW 应用程序似乎适合您;但是、您想收集更大的数据集、这是正确的吗?

    ...在 ADCPro 中、您可以使用数据记录器工具执行此操作(有关 如何将此工具用于单次采集的一些说明、请参阅 e2e.ti.com/.../2915432;但是、您也可以单击"Auto"(自动)按钮并执行将记录到多个文件的连续采集)。 在 LabVIEW 驱动程序中、您只需多次调用 collect subVI (例如、在 for 循环中)。

    但愿这有所帮助。
  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    您好、Chris

    感谢您的回答。

     

    我想通过 LabVIEW 收集数据。 连续测量、例如连续24小时。

     

    1.当循环处理示例程序的 sub-VI 的 collect.vi 时,1个循环需要一秒钟以上的时间。

    因此、最简单的测量的命令(协议)是什么? 您可以分享 VI 示例吗?

    2.此计算机的 USB 原始连接级别是否为? 此外,USB 管道是“控制方法”还是“批量方法”还是“其它”?

     

    非常感谢你的帮助。

     

    Kunihiko H.

     

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。
    您好、Kunihiko、

    除非您以最慢的数据速率之一运行 ADS1263EVM-PDK 并配置较大的块大小、否则我怀疑它能够收集24小时的连续数据(在此时间段内、您可以收集多个数据块、 但很可能、块之间会存在数据缺失的缺口)。

    MMB0将数据收集到存储器中、然后将存储器中的所有数据发送到 PC (我认为这是通过批量传输完成的)。 遗憾的是、在此期间、MMB0不会继续收集数据、因此在数据传输之间可能无法捕获部分 ADC 转换。 这是 EVM 的一个限制、即它不允许进行非常长期的数据采集。

    独立的 LabVIEW 驱动程序是 ADCPro 如何采集数据的示例。 我没有任何其他示例 VIS。 也许您可以尝试使用较小的块大小(LabVIEW 驱动程序强制使用一些最小块大小、但我不确定原因); 但是、对于足够小的块大小和较慢的数据速率、MMB0可能能够足够快地将数据传输到 PC、以便不会丢失任何数据。 遗憾的是、该 EVM 只是设计为无法将实时数据流式传输到 PC。
  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    您好、Chris

     

    感谢您的回答。 感谢您对 MMB0的评论。 它非常有用。

    我检查是否可以通过 Lab View 程序执行处理。

    谢谢你。

     

    Kunihiko H.